Tim;  Composer reads n3 just the same as an owl file.  Drag/drop it
into a project and double-click to open.

The specific complaint may matter.  Chances are it's that the base URI
doesn't exist (?).  In which case adding a base URI to the file should
suffice.  There could be other problems with the n3 file, so take a
look at the error log or other place where the complaint is specified.
